- Security deposit
- A refundable security deposit is taken at the base by card swipe or cash. The exact amount is confirmed at quote time; refunded after handover provided the boat and inventory are returned undamaged.
- Cancellation
- Cancellation terms are operator-specific and disclosed in the charter contract before payment. As a rule, most Mediterranean operators retain the full charter fee within 30 days of departure; we recommend charter cancellation insurance via a UK broker (typically 4-5% of the charter fee).

Gocek Bay & the Lycian Coast
Sheltered bays, almost no swell, great for non-sailing partners. Ottoman ruins at Cleopatra Bay.
